Acer Campestre is a medium-sized tree with a dense and spreading canopy. The tree can grow up to 20m tall, with a trunk diameter of up to 1m. The bark is grey-brown and develops shallow grooves and ridges as it ages. The leaves are 5-lobed, with a serrated margin, and are green in color.

The hedge maple (Acer campestre) is a small deciduous tree popular in the urban environment and as foundation plantings in the landscape.The wood has various uses as timber and was used by famous violin maker Antonio Stradivari for some of his creations. This tree is included with the other maple trees in the Sapindaceae (soapberry) family, and is of the Acer genus.

Acer campestre. A medium sized tree up to 12 m high. The crown is a-symmetric because of the irregular growth of the branches. The branches have conspicuous corky fissures, both on mature and young wood. Juvenile foliage may have a reddish look when it unfurls, but soon turns dark green. Acer campestre is commonly called hedge maple. It is native to Europe and western Asia, frequently being found on plains, hills and along rivers. It is also sometimes commonly called field maple ( campestre meaning from fields). Broadleaf deciduous tree, 25-45+ ft (7.6-13.7+ m) high, dense, rounded. Leaves opposite, simple, 5-10 cm, with 3-5 rounded, entire lobes, dark green above, when detached yield a milky sap, a characteristic shared with A. platanoides and A. macrophyllum . Foliage turns yellow or golden in fall, one of the last trees to color.

Acer campestre is a deciduous Tree growing to 15 m (49ft 3in) at a fast rate. See above for USDA hardiness. It is hardy to UK zone 4 and is not frost tender. It is in flower from May to June, and the seeds ripen from September to October.. The leaves are packed around apples, rootcrops etc to help preserve them[18, 20]. A fast growing plant.

The field maple, Acer campestre, is the UK's only native maple tree.Typically found growing in woods and hedgerows, it's a medium-sized, deciduous tree with a rounded, bushy crown. It has attractive lobed leaves that turn golden yellow in autumn, and tiny flowers in spring that are followed by papery winged fruits, known as samaras.

Common name: field maple. Scientific name: Acer campestre. Family: Sapindaceae. Origin: native. The bark is light brown and flaky, and twigs are slender and brown and develop a corky bark with age. Small, grey leaf buds grow on long stems. Field maples can grow to 20m and live for up to 350 years.

Acer campestre, known as the field maple, is a flowering plant species in the family Sapindaceae.It is native to much of continental Europe, Britain, southwest Asia from Turkey to the Caucasus, and north Africa in the Atlas Mountains.It has been widely planted, and is introduced outside its native range in Europe and areas of USA and Western Australia with suitable climate.
